Description

Dive into an immersive audio experience with the M-Audio Audiophile Firewire, a sleek and versatile audio/MIDI interface designed to elevate your studio recording and live performance setups. This powerhouse device is a testament to M-Audio's legacy of delivering top-tier sound quality and functionality. Featuring zero-latency hardware direct monitoring, it ensures that your audio is as immediate and precise as your performance. Ideal for musicians, producers, and digital DJs alike, it offers a flexible 4 x 6 audio I/O configuration that seamlessly integrates with your setup, whether you're mixing in a home studio or performing live.

The Audiophile Firewire's intuitive design includes a stereo headphone output with A/B switching, so you can effortlessly cue tracks and manage your audio sources with precision. The versatile aux bus is perfect for crafting dedicated headphone mixes or sending effects, while the 1 x 1 MIDI I/O supports your MIDI gear for a complete music production experience. Plus, with its rugged steel construction, this interface is built to withstand the rigors of the road.

Key Features:

  • 4 x 6 24-bit/96kHz audio I/O
  • 2 x 4 analog operation with RCA connections
  • Digital S/PDIF (coaxial) I/O supporting 2-channel PCM and AC-3/DTS surround sound
  • Stereo headphone output with dedicated level control
  • Zero-latency hardware direct monitoring
  • Low-latency ASIO software direct monitoring
  • 1 x 1 MIDI I/O
  • Flexible software-controlled mixing for hardware and software I/O
  • Aux sends on all channels for enhanced mixing capabilities
  • Powered via FireWire bus or included DC power supply
  • Durable steel construction for reliable performance

M-Audio Firewire Audiophile

soundonsound.com

The M-Audio Firewire Audiophile impresses with its affordability and flexibility, offering more inputs, outputs, and routing options compared to similarly priced USB alternatives. Its use of Firewire allows for low latency and greater bandwidth, appealing to live performers and DJs who need multiple outputs and MIDI control. However, the lack of balanced connections and preamps limits its suitability as a central hub for laptop-based recording. Additionally, the device is plagued by driver issues on Mac OS X, particularly in handling sleep mode, which can disrupt workflow. While it holds promise, these shortcomings prevent it from being a definitive choice for all users.
